直播SDK的多人连麦功能哪家最稳定?

互动直播风靡的今天,多人连麦功能已经成为衡量一个直播平台互动能力的关键指标。无论是线上教育、语音社交还是电商带货,流畅、稳定的多人连麦体验都是留住用户的核心。对于开发者而言,选择一款底层技术过硬、服务可靠的直播SDK,就如同为自家的应用搭建了一座坚实可靠的通信桥梁。那么,面对市场上众多的技术方案,我们该如何评判其稳定性,并为自己的项目做出最佳选择呢?本文将深入探讨几个关键维度,帮助您找到答案。

核心技术架构剖析

稳定性并非空中楼阁,它根植于底层技术架构的先进性。一个优秀的多人连麦方案,其核心在于如何高效、智能地调度和管理全球范围内的实时音视频流。

首先,全球软件定义实时网络(SD-RTN)是关键。这种专为实时互动设计的网络,区别于传统的互联网,它通过智能路由算法,能够自动为每一条数据流选择最优、最通畅的传输路径。这意味着,即使在全球不同地区的用户同时连麦,也能有效避免网络拥堵和延迟抖动,从而保障通话的流畅性。例如,服务商声网所构建的全球虚拟通信网,就是这一理念的实践,它通过遍布全球的边缘节点和智能动态路由,极大提升了连接的可靠性。

其次,在面对复杂网络环境时,强大的网络适应能力至关重要。这包括前向纠错(FEC)、自动重传请求(ARQ)以及抗丢包编解码器等技术。当网络出现轻微波动或丢包时,这些技术能在不依赖重传的情况下,尽可能修复丢失的数据包,保证声音和画面的连贯性。有行业报告指出,具备先进抗丢包技术的SDK,在高达70%的网络丢包环境下,依然能够保持语音的可懂度,这对于用户体验来说是质的飞跃。

性能指标量化对比

谈论稳定性不能只停留在概念上,必须落实到可量化、可测量的性能指标上。开发者可以通过这些硬性指标来客观评估不同SDK的表现。

最为核心的三个指标是:端到端延迟卡顿率接通率。端到端延迟指的是声音从主播端采集到连麦观众端播放出来的时间差,理想状态应控制在400毫秒以内,以达到“面对面”交谈的体验。卡顿率则反映了音视频播放过程中的停顿频率,高卡顿率会直接导致体验流失。接通率衡量的是连麦请求的成功概率,高接通率是稳定性的最基本保障。

为了方便对比,我们可以参考一些服务商公开的数据报告(注:数据仅为示例,请以官方最新数据为准):

<td><strong>性能指标</strong></td>  
<td><strong>优异表现</strong></td>  
<td><strong>行业平均水平</strong></td>  

<td>端到端延迟</td>  
<td>&lt; 400ms</td>  
<td>500 - 800ms</td>  

<td>音频卡顿率</td>  
<td>&lt; 1%</td>  
<td>3% - 5%</td>  

<td>连麦接通率</td>  
<td>&gt; 99%</td>  
<td>95% - 98%</td>  

除了上述基础指标,音画同步也是一个容易被忽视但极其影响体验的细节。尤其在K歌、配音等场景下,口型与声音的细微偏差都会显得很突兀。优秀的SDK会通过精密的时间戳管理,确保音画同步误差在极低的范围内。

实际场景的抗压能力

实验室环境下的优异数据,未必能完全代表真实世界的复杂情况。稳定性最终需要在各种极端和常见的用户场景中接受考验。

一个典型的压力场景是高并发和弱网络环境。例如,在一个大型在线课堂上,瞬间可能有数十甚至上百名学生同时举手申请连麦。此时,SDK能否快速、平稳地处理好大量并发的链接请求,而不导致服务端崩溃或延迟激增,是检验其稳定性的试金石。同样,当用户在地铁、电梯等网络信号不稳定的场所参与连麦时,SDK的网络自适应算法能否快速平滑地切换链路,避免通话中断,也至关重要。

另一个考量点是设备兼容性和后台存活能力。市场上安卓手机品牌和系统版本碎片化严重,一款稳定的SDK必须经过海量真机测试,确保在绝大多数设备上都能稳定运行。此外,在移动端,当应用切换到后台时,如何保持语音通话的持续性,同时合理控制电量消耗,也是技术上的一个挑战。这需要服务商对移动操作系统的底层机制有深刻理解。

开发者体验与支持

SDK的稳定性不仅体现在运行时,也贯穿于整个集成、测试和运维阶段。顺畅的开发者体验能间接保障最终产品的稳定上线和运营。

首先,文档的详尽程度和易读性是第一步。清晰易懂的API文档、丰富的示例代码以及常见的“坑点”说明,能极大降低开发者的集成难度,避免因错误调用API而引发的稳定性问题。其次,调试工具的完备性也非常关键。是否提供了能够实时查看网络质量、通话质量(如丢包、延迟)的诊断工具?当问题发生时,这些工具能帮助开发者快速定位问题是出在自身网络、服务端还是SDK本身。

  • 完善的文档与示例: 降低集成门槛,避免人为错误。
  • 强大的诊断工具: 快速定位问题,提升排查效率。
  • 专业的技术支持: 遇到难题时,能获得及时、有效的帮助。

最后,专业、及时的技术支持是最后的保障。再稳定的服务也可能遇到突发状况,一个拥有7×24小时技术支持团队的服务商,能够在关键时刻提供解决方案,最大程度减少对用户的影响。

综合评估与未来展望

回归到最初的问题——“直播SDK的多人连麦功能哪家最稳定?”通过以上分析,我们可以看出,稳定性是一个多维度的综合概念。它不仅仅取决于技术架构的先进性和性能数据的优劣,还与实际场景下的适应能力、以及对开发者的支持体系密切相关。

总结来看,一个真正稳定的多人连麦解决方案应具备以下特质:

  • 坚如磐石的底层网络: 依托全球化的专用网络,保障低延迟、高畅通的连接。
  • 智能高效的抗劣化能力: 在面对网络波动时,能自动、平滑地维持通话质量。
  • 经得起考验的真实表现: 在高峰并发和复杂网络环境下,依然表现可靠。
  • 贴心周全的开发者服务: 从集成到运维,为开发者扫清障碍。

展望未来,随着5G、AI和元宇宙等技术的发展,多人实时互动将向着更高清晰度(如4K)、更沉浸式(如VR/AR)的方向演进。这对实时音视频的稳定性和传输效率提出了更高的要求。服务商需要持续投入底层技术的研发,例如利用AI进行更精准的网络预测和流量调度,以应对未来的挑战。对于开发者而言,选择一家技术储备深厚、持续创新且值得信赖的合作伙伴,无疑是确保自身应用在激烈竞争中保持领先的关键一步。而像声网这样的服务商,其长期积累的技术优势和全球基础设施,为解决稳定性的核心难题提供了坚实的基础。

分享到